Kenya reaffirms solidarity as UAE raises concern over Gulf Infrastructure attacks

"He apprised me on the gravity of the situation in the region, and in particular the repercussions of IRGC’s unjustified attacks of critical infrastructure of GCC countries on not only civilian security, but economic and environmental security of the Globe," the Foreign Affairs..
✨ Key Highlights
The United Arab Emirates has voiced serious global concerns over attacks on Gulf infrastructure, which it blames on Iran's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C). Kenya has reaffirmed its solidarity with the UAE and pledged diplomatic support to address the escalating situation.
- UAE Assistant Minister of Foreign Affairs Abdulla Balalaa warned of "far-reaching economic and environmental impacts worldwide" from the attacks.
- Key figures involved include Abdulla Balalaa and Kenya's Foreign Affairs Principal Secretary Korir Sing’Oei, conveying messages on behalf of President William Ruto.
- Reports indicate the IRGC has targeted critical industrial, civilian, and economic infrastructure in UAE, Bahrain, Kuwait, and Saudi Arabia in March and April 2026.
